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is the "Substrate transport apparatus with double substrate holders." This innovative substrate processing apparatus includes a supply of substrates, a substrate transport module, and a substrate processing module. The transport module features a movable arm assembly with two substrate holders mounted to it. Each substrate holder is designed with two separate holding areas, allowing for the simultaneous handling of two substrates. The movable arm assembly is equipped with two pairs of driven arms, with each pair connected to a separate holder for extending and retracting the holders along a radial path relative to the center of the movable arm assembly.
